Cheapest Available Lathrop Apartments for Rent

 

The cheapest available apartment rental in Lathrop, CA is a 2 Beds unit found at Captains Cove in the Woodbridge neighborhood priced from $1,650. Fairway Estates in the Woodbridge neighborhood has the second lowest priced unit, which is a 1 Bed apartment currently listed from $1,699. Best Value Apartments for Rent in Lathrop, CA

As of December 12, 2025 the best value apartment in the Lathrop area is the $2.17 price per square foot Delta Model at Escala at Stanford Crossing in the in the Mossdale Landing neighborhood starting from $2,930. The second greatest value Lathrop apartment is the 3BR/1.0BA Model at Union North Apartments starting at $2,100 with a $2.27 price per square foot in the Woodbridge neighborhood. Getting Around Lathrop, CA

Walk Score®

28 / 100

Car-Dependent

Most errands require a car

Bike Score®

36 / 100

Somewhat Bikeable

Minimal bike infrastructure
